RECITALS


(A)

The Borrower is a Swiss share corporation (Aktiengesellschaft) with domicile at Avenue des Sports 42, CH-1400 Yverdon-les-Bains, Switzerland and listed in the main board of the SIX Swiss Exchange. The Borrower develops and manufactures customized electric energy storage solutions for industrial applications in the form of large format lithium-ion cells, batteries and battery modules and offers to its customers a broad range of battery related services. The Borrower also distributes standard batteries and related accessories in Switzerland. Its main businesses are Stationary Electricity Storage Solutions, Portable Energy Storage Solutions and Distribution Products.


(B)

The Transferor Lender is a share corporation incorporated under the laws of the State of Colorado and is a publicly traded company listed as OGES on the OTC, whose primary business is the licensing, further development, manufacturing and marketing of products incorporating thin film battery technologies.


(C)

Precept Fund Management SPC, with domicile at Ground Floor, Harbour Centre, 42 North Church Street, P.O. Box 1569, George Town, Grand Cayman KY1-1110, Cayman Islands ("Precept") on behalf of Precept Fund Segregated Portfolio ("Precept SP") is currently majority shareholder of the Borrower and Precept on behalf of Prescient Fund Segregated Portfolio and on behalf of Precept SP is currently the majority shareholder of the Transferor Lender.


(D)

On 8 July 2013, the Borrower and Precept SP entered into a loan agreement (the "Loan Agreement") under which Precept SP granted the Borrower a 2 per cent. CHF 17m (Swiss Franc seventeen million) three year term loan convertible into registered shares of the Borrower and secured by assets of the Borrower that has been fully (i) drawn by the Borrower and (ii) converted by Precept SP into registered shares of the Borrower. The Loan Agreement has been terminated.




3




(E)

On 3 March 2014, Precept SP issued a letter of support with respect to the Borrower. The Letter of Support confirmed Precept's willingness (on the basis of the Borrower's management anticipating working capital cash requirements of about CHF 1'300'000 by December 2013) to continue fully supporting the Borrower's business, including taking such steps within its powers at least until 31 March 2015 to facilitate the provision of additional funding as reasonably requested by the Board upon showing a need of such funding.


(F)

On 30 May 2014, the Borrower and the Transferor Lender, which is a majority-owned subsidiary of Precept, entered into a loan agreement (the "Convertible Loan and Investment Agreement") under which the Transferor Lender granted the Borrower a 2 per cent. CHF 3m (Swiss Franc three million) two year term loan due in 2016, convertible into registered shares of the Borrower and secured by assets of the Borrower and the Subsidiary.


(G)

By an amendment and restatement agreement dated 2 August 2014, the Borrower and the Transferor Lender agreed to increase the loan amount of the CLIA by CHF 2m to a total of CHF 5m (Swiss Franc five million) that has been fully drawn by the Borrower (the "Amended and Restated CLIA").


(H)

The Transferor Lender now wishes to sell, transfer and assign the CLIA together with all security granted by the Borrower pursuant to clause 2.3 CLIA to the Transferee Lender and the Transferee Lender is willing to purchase and acquire the CLIA together with all security with the consent of the Borrower and the Subsidiary (the "Transaction").

2.

 OBJECTS OF SALE AND PURCHASE

2.1

Sale and Purchase of the Assets

Subject to the terms and conditions of this Agreement,

(i)

the Transferor Lender agrees to sell, transfer and assign, and herewith sells, transfers and assigns with effect as per Closing, and the Transferee Lender agrees to purchase and accept the Transferred Items, whereby the Transferee Lender will assume all rights and obligations of the Transferor Lender under, and replace the Transferor Lender as a party to, the Transferred Contract and the Transferred Security Agreements, once this Agreement has been completed pursuant to Clause 5;


(ii)

the Borrower consents to the sale, transfer and assignment of the Transferred Items, and of all rights and obligations thereunder and, accordingly, to the replacement of the Transferor Lender by the Transferee Lender as a party to the Transferred Contract and the Transferred Security Agreements as per Closing, fully entitled to all rights, claims and security rights existing thereunder;


(iii)

the Subsidiary consents to the sale, transfer and assignment of the Share Pledge Agreement (to the extent this is required), and of all rights and obligations thereunder, and, accordingly, to the replacement of the Transferor Lender by the Transferee Lender as a party thereto as per Closing, fully entitled to all rights, claims and security rights existing under the Share Pledge Agreement; and




6




the Borrower, the Subsidiary and the Transferor Lender shall upon reasonable request of the Transferee Lender co-operate with the Transferee Lender and use their best endeavours in assisting the Transferee Lender with regard to all steps required to effect the transactions contemplated by this Agreement.


For the avoidance of doubt, as from Closing, any reference in the definitions of "Secured Obligations" in the Security Agreement and in the IP Pledge Agreement to (i) "Assignee" and "Pledgee", respectively, shall refer to the Transferee Lender.


2.2

Transfer of Risk and Benefit / No Assumption of Liabilities

Unless explicitly provided otherwise herein, the benefit and the risk of the Transferred Items (Übergang von Nutzen und Gefahr) shall pass to the Transferee Lender on the Closing Date.


3.

  PURCHASE PRICE

The purchase price to be paid by the Transferee Lender with regard to the sale of the Transferred Items shall be CHF 5'250'000.00 (the "Purchase Price"). The accrued interest (the "Accrued Interest") on the Amended and Restated CLIA per 31 January 2015 in the amount of CHF 58'000.00, calculated in line with the spread sheet set forth in Schedule 5, shall be paid by the Borrower to the Transferor Lender as set forth in Clause 4 below.

5.

  CLOSING

5.1

Date and Place of Closing

Subject to the satisfaction or waiver of the conditions to Closing set forth in Clause 5.2, the Closing shall take place at the offices of Prager Dreifuss AG, Mühlebachstrasse 6, 8008 Zurich, Switzerland (or such other place as the parties may agree in writing) at 9am CET on the fifth Business Day following satisfaction of the conditions precedent set forth in Clause 5.2 but in no event later than on 31 January 2015 (the "Long Stop Date"), unless mutually agreed otherwise between the parties (the "Closing Date").


If Closing has not taken place by the Long Stop Date, each party may withdraw from this Agreement by giving written notice to the other parties except that each party shall forfeit such right if it willfully or grossly negligently prevents or interferes with the satisfaction of the conditions to Closing set forth in Clause 5.2. If this Agreement is terminated, such termination shall be without liability of the terminating party, provided that if such termination is the result of the willful or grossly negligent misconduct of a party, such defaulting party shall be liable for any damage, loss, cost or expense incurred or sustained as a result of such misconduct.


5.2

Conditions to Closing

The obligations of each party to complete the transactions contemplated by this Agreement shall be subject to the satisfaction or waiver (by the party in whose favour such conditions precedent are stated) on the Closing Date of all the conditions precedent set forth below:


5.2.1

Performance Obligations

Each of the parties shall have performed and / or complied with all its obligations and covenants under this Agreement which are or become due before the Closing Date.


5.2.2

Approval by the Extraordinary Shareholders Meeting of the Borrower

The Extraordinary Shareholders Meeting of the Borrower (the "EGM") shall have (i) elected the two directors nominated by the Transferee Lender and (ii) approved all resolutions in accordance with the proposals made by the board of directors of the


8




Borrower in the final draft invitation to the EGM attached as Schedule 6, and the filing of the relevant documentation with the commercial register shall have occurred within three Business Days after the EGM.


5.2.3

Exemption granted by Swiss Takeover Board

The Swiss Takeover Board shall have granted a final, not appealable exemption from the duty to make a mandatory offer in accordance with the draft request attached as Schedule 7.


5.2.4

No withdrawal of payment instructions

The Transferor Lender has not withdrawn its payment instructions pursuant to Clause 4.


5.2.5

Notice of payment instructions to the Borrower and Bruellan (Article 470(1) CO)

The Transferor Lender shall inform Bruellan about the payment instructions pursuant to Clause 4. The Borrower confirms having taken notice of the payment instruction in its favour by signing this Agreement.


5.2.6

Confirmation and Agreement of Bruellan

Bruellan shall have provided to Precept and the Transferee Lender a written confirmation materially in the form as set forth in Schedule 8, confirming (i) that it will, immediately upon receipt of such part of the Purchase Price payable to Bruellan as per Clause 4, duly execute a confirmation of receipt of payment and release from obligations and deliver to Precept the original of such confirmation, (ii) that it has taken note of the payment instruction in Clause 4 in its favour, and (iii) that it will adhere to the terms of Clause 9.5 of this Agreement.


5.2.7

No Judgment, no Event of Default

(i)

The Closing shall not have been prohibited by a judgment or order and there shall be no claim pending which is reasonably likely to be successful and which seeks to prohibit the Closing.


(ii)

No Event of Default has occurred.


5.2.8

Approvals by the Parties

(i)

The competent corporate management body of the Transferor Lender shall have approved the sale, transfer and assignment of the Transferred Items pursuant to, and the execution and completion of, this Agreement by the Transferor Lender.


(ii)

The competent corporate or management body of the Transferee Lender shall have approved the purchase and acceptance of the Transferred Items pursuant to, and the execution and completion of, this Agreement by the Transferee Lender.




9




(iii)

The competent corporate or management body of the Borrower shall have approved the execution and completion of this Agreement by the Borrower and the Subsidiary.


(iv)

The competent corporate or management body of the Subsidiary shall have approved the execution and completion of this Agreement by the Subsidiary.


5.2.9

Delivery of Statement of Outstanding Claims under the Amended and Restated CLIA, Release and no Event of Default

On the Closing Date, the Borrower shall have delivered to the Transferor Lender and the Transferee Lender:


(i)

a statement of all claims (principal, interest, fees and expenses) existing under or in connection with the Amended and Restated CLIA as per the Closing Date in the form attached as Schedule 9 confirming that these amounts are owed, due and outstanding;


(ii)

a formal release of Precept from any obligations under the letter of support as set forth in Schedule 10;


(iii)

a written confirmation, dated as of the Closing Date, that no Event of Default has occurred; and


(iv)

a written confirmation, dated as of the Closing Date, that no representations and warranties under the Amended and Restated CLIA have been breached.


5.2.10Preparation of conversion resulting in 9.99% of the Borrower's share capital

On the Closing Date, the Transferee Lender shall have taken all necessary steps and shall have prepared all necessary documents (incl. the appointment of the bank, the conversion and subscription declaration, the set-off declaration, etc.) in cooperation with, and with the support of, the Borrower to allow for a conversion as per section 7 of the Amended and Restated CLIA to such extent that the Transferee Lender shall hold, as of the Closing Date, 9.99% of the Borrower's share capital, calculated on a post-conversion basis.

9.5

Dilution

(i)

The Transferee Lender undertakes to the Transferor Lender that the Transferee Lender (or its affiliates) will not convert the Transferred Contract and the Convertible Loan Agreement dated 7 December 2014 (the "Convertible Loan Agreement") into shares of, or accept bonus shares (Gratisaktien) of the Borrower, to the extent that the issuance of shares so converted or accepted would result in the shareholding of Precept and/or OGES being diluted below 33 1/3% of the total outstanding share capital of the Borrower, at any point in time.


(ii)

The Transferee Lender's obligation under Clause 9.5(i) shall not apply in the following circumstances:


(A)

the conversion of the Transferred Contract into shares occurs prior to conversions under the Convertible Loan Agreement (it being understood that this subsection exempts only the conversion of the Transferred Contract into shares from the obligations pursuant to clause 9.5(i)); or




16




(B)

the Borrower successfully conducts a rights issue (including a rights issue in order to cover a Shortfall (as defined in the Convertible Loan Agreement)) or successfully conducts any other form of equity financing, including by way of private placements (it being understood that a convertible debt instrument will be considered as equity financing in the sense of this subsection (B) only once it has been fully converted into equity of the Borrower).  


"Sucessfully" means in this subsection (B) that new shares have been subscribed (in cash or in kind) at least at par value.


(iii)

The obligation of the Transferee Lender under Clause 9.5(i) terminates if Precept and/or OGES and/or any other of their affiliates (the "Precept Group") have sold more than 760'000 shares in the Borrower (it being understood that any sales, transfers or disposals of Leclanché shares (Y) from one entity of the Precept Group to another entity of the Precept Group and/or (Z) that any entity of the Precept Group has acquired or subscribed for since the date of this Agreement, shall not count towards the sale of the 760'000 shares).


(iv)

For the avoidance of doubt,it is understood that the undertakings under this Clause 9.5 are obligations of the Transferee Lender, but not of the other parties hereto.
